Vulnerability Description
An Unrestricted File Upload Vulnerability in the SupportCandy plugin through 2.0.0 for WordPress all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code by uploading a file with an executable extension.

What is CVE-2019-11223?
CVE-2019-11223 is a vulnerability with a CVSS score of 9.8 (CRITICAL). An Unrestricted File Upload Vulnerability in the SupportCandy plugin through 2.0.0 for WordPress all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code by uploading a file with an executable extension.
How severe is CVE-2019-11223?
CVE-2019-11223 has been rated CRITICAL with a CVSS base score of 9.8/10. This is considered a critical vulnerability requiring immediate attention.
